Program Director

This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Program Director in United States.

This senior leadership role is responsible for driving the end-to-end success of large-scale technology services programs, combining strategic oversight with hands-on delivery leadership. You will own the client relationship at an executive level while ensuring program execution remains aligned, predictable, and high quality. The role requires balancing strategic vision with operational awareness, enabling you to anticipate risks, resolve issues early, and maintain strong delivery health across complex, cross-functional teams. You will lead large distributed teams, shape program direction, and ensure all workstreams contribute to measurable client outcomes. In addition, you will act as a trusted advisor, building confidence through clear communication, strong judgment, and consistent results. This is a remote role with occasional travel and significant exposure to high-impact enterprise environments.

Accountabilities:
  • Lead end-to-end program delivery across large-scale technology engagements, ensuring alignment across strategy, execution, and client outcomes
  • Build and maintain senior client relationships, acting as a trusted executive-level partner and primary program contact
  • Define program vision, strategy, and roadmap while ensuring cross-functional teams remain aligned on priorities and delivery goals
  • Oversee a distributed team of 40–50 professionals, ensuring clarity of ownership, accountability, and performance
  • Monitor program health, risks, financial performance, and delivery quality, proactively addressing issues before escalation
  • Drive continuous improvement across delivery processes, team structures, and operational efficiency
  • Collaborate closely with internal stakeholders to ensure commercial alignment, resource planning, and account growth opportunities
Requirements:
  • 10+ years of experience leading large-scale technology or consulting programs in complex client environments
  • Proven experience managing programs of $5M+ annually with responsibility for budget, margin, and financial performance
  • Demonstrated leadership of large, cross-functional teams (30+ members) across distributed environments
  • Strong executive communication skills with the ability to influence senior stakeholders and clients
  • Proven ability to manage complex client relationships and navigate high-stakes organizational dynamics
  • Experience making strategic resourcing and delivery decisions that balance performance and profitability
  • Strong commercial acumen with the ability to identify risks and support account growth and renewals
  • Experience working within Agile delivery frameworks and global teams
Benefits:
  • Competitive salary range of $100,000 – $120,000 USD
  •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ance coverage
  • 401(k) with company contribution
  • Generous PTO and 15 company-wide holidays
  • Paid parental leave
  • Remote-first flexibility with a strong emphasis on work-life balance
  • Career growth opportunities within a global, innovation-driven organization
  • Inclusive and diverse workplace culture with active employee resource groups
